The S&P Europe 350 Dividend Aristocrats is the European equivalent of the S&P 500 Dividend Aristocrats. It is a stock index of European constituents that have followed a policy of consistently increasing dividends every year for at least 10 consecutive years. [1] The index was launched on May 2, 2005.

Specifically, such companies must be part of the S&P 500 and ...A dividend aristocrat is a company that’s raised its dividend payment every year for the past 25 years or longer. The company also must be a member of the S&P 500 to qualify. A company that holds its dividend steady or reduces its dividend at any point loses dividend aristocrat status until it rebuilds a 25year history of dividend …Jun 24, 2022 · S&P 500 Dividend Aristocrats.
